All of the following are factors to consider when determining a taxpayer's California residency status, EXCEPT:
Amount of time spent in California versus amount of time spent outside California.
Permanence of work assignments in California.
State in which the taxpayer is registered to vote.
State in which the taxpayer will pay the least amount of tax

All Answers 1

Answered by GPT-5 mini AI
State in which the taxpayer will pay the least amount of tax.

California residency determinations consider time spent in state, permanency of work assignments, voter registration, driver's license, home/family location, etc., but not a taxpayer’s choice of state based solely on minimizing taxes.
